New Focus Auto Signs Strategic Distributorship with MICHELIN

  • Exclusive distribution of MICHELIN branded auto accessory products in Mainland China

HONG KONG, SHANGHAI and TAIPEI, Jan. 23,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- New Focus Auto Tech Holdings Ltd. ("NFA" or the "Company") (HKEX 0360, TWSE 9106) announced the completion of a licensing agreement with world leading tire manufacturer, Michelin, for the manufacturing and distribution of MICHELIN branded auto accessory products in Mainland China.

The agreement is a 3-year contract whereby New Focus Lighting & Power Technology (Shanghai) Co., Ltd, a fully-owned subsidiary of NFA Group will manufacture MICHELIN products. These include a series of auto related consumer accessories such as DC/AC power inverter, 12V electrical cooler & warmer boxes, 4-in-1 multi-purpose emergency jumpstart, series of LED work light, booster cables, car beautification kits and many other exciting new products.

In this undertaking, NFA will be responsible for product development, promotional planning, sales, distribution and after-sales services in the China market.  All products will be distributed through NFA's 100+ direct-owned service retail chains, its cross-region wholesale channels throughout Greater China and also through other retail stores. A renewable option to extend the agreement for another 2 years can be negotiated.

About NFA

New Focus Auto is the leading automobile after-sales service provider in Greater China.  It currently operates more than 100+ direct-own outlets throughout Greater China region, providing basic automobile maintenance, car wash, professional detailing, modifications, body repairs and the sales of auto accessory products. In addition to direct-own stores, New Focus also manufactures, wholesales & distributes various auto accessory products throughout Greater China and other North America & European markets.

About New Focus Lighting & Power Technology (Shanghai) Co., Ltd

Founded in 1989, NFA's manufacturing unit was once the major profit generator - focusing on automotive electronics and power-related parts & accessories; over 80% of its sales is for export, mainly North America, to customers such as Canadian Tire, Costco, Autozone and Walmart, etc. NFA has de-emphasized its manufacturing business in recent years and has transformed from a car parts manufacturer to a leading auto parts distributor as well as one of the largest after-sales service retail chains operator in Greater China.

ABOUT MICHELIN

Dedicated to the improvement of sustainable mobility, Michelin designs, manufactures and sells tires for every type of vehicle, including airplanes, automobiles, bicycles, earthmovers, farm equipment, heavy-duty trucks and motorcycles. Michelin employs 115,000 people, has sales organizations in more than 170 countries and operates 69 production sites in 18 countries throughout five continents. The company also publishes travel guides, hotel and restaurant guides, maps and road atlases and offers electronic mobility support services, on ViaMichelin.com. Research and innovation development is being taken care of in technology centres in Asia, Europe and North America.

About Michelin Lifestyle

Michelin Lifestyle Ltd. is a subsidiary of the Michelin Group charged with the management of its brand extension program using the licensing model.  Michelin Lifestyle was established in 2000 to increase the recognition of MICHELIN brand and to develop closer relationships with consumers.  In 2011, Michelin Lifestyle operations represented more than 75 licensing partnerships worldwide; sales in over 85 countries and through more than 30,000 outlets, including the leading automotive accessory chains.
